About This Curriculum

A content-based, digital-first K-5 ELA curriculum driven by the science of reading that combines systematic instruction on the five components of reading with compelling content and knowledge building. Emphasizes mastery of knowledge and skills, high-quality student work, and character development.

What makes it unique: Content-based approach combining systematic reading instruction with real-world texts and knowledge building, designed to transition students from learning to read to reading to learn

Imagine Learning EL Education K-5: Science of Reading-Based Digital Curriculum

Imagine Learning EL Education K-5 Language Arts is a content-based, digital-first curriculum that integrates systematic reading instruction with knowledge-building across academic domains. The curriculum emphasizes mastery-based learning and combines the five components of reading with compelling content to develop both decoding skills and background knowledge.

Evaluation Criteria

4 strengths · 5 neutral

Knowledge RichStrength

The curriculum explicitly emphasizes knowledge building through texts and content-based approach across academic domains.

EdReports Gateway 2 'Meets Expectations' for building knowledge through texts, and curriculum description emphasizes 'compelling content and knowledge building'

Text ComplexityStrength

EdReports confirms the curriculum meets expectations for grade-level text demands and appropriate complexity.

Gateway 1 'Meets Expectations' rating specifically addresses 'alignment to grade-level text demands' and text quality

Direct InstructionStrength

The mastery-based pedagogy and systematic instruction approach align with direct instruction principles.

Curriculum uses 'mastery-based' pedagogy and 'systematic instruction,' indicating structured, explicit teaching methods

Systematic PhonicsStrength

The curriculum is described as driven by the science of reading with systematic instruction on the five components of reading.

Marketing materials emphasize 'science of reading' foundation and 'systematic instruction on the five components of reading'

Teacher TrainingNeutral

EdReports indicates the curriculum meets expectations for teacher support and usability.

Gateway 3 'Meets Expectations' for usability includes teacher support components, though depth of professional development not specified

Retrieval PracticeNeutral

The mastery-based approach suggests review and practice components, though specific retrieval methods are not detailed.

Mastery-based pedagogy implies repeated practice and assessment, but specific retrieval practice techniques not described

Vocabulary BuildingNeutral

The content-based approach and knowledge-building emphasis suggest vocabulary development, though specific methods are not detailed.

EdReports Gateway 2 approval for knowledge building through texts implies vocabulary instruction, but specific vocabulary strategies not specified

Writing InstructionNeutral

The curriculum emphasizes high-quality student work, suggesting structured writing components.

Curriculum description mentions 'high-quality student work' as a key emphasis, though specific writing instruction details not provided

Whole Books Vs ExcerptsNeutral

EdReports indicates the curriculum meets expectations for text quality and complexity, suggesting use of complete, grade-appropriate texts.

Gateway 1 rating of 'Meets Expectations' for text quality and range indicates appropriate text selection, though specific whole book vs. excerpt balance is not detailed
